Mueller Landscape Inc, a staple in the San Diego landscaping scene since 1982, is looking for a Crew Leader to manage and oversee the maintenance of residential landscapes.

This role involves leading a small team, usually with one helper, to ensure high-quality garden and landscape maintenance.

The Crew Leader will work closely with the office team to report and address various landscaping issues, contributing to our commitment to excellent customer service and detailed landscape care.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Safety Compliance: Implement safety protocols to ensure a safe work environment for all crew members.
  • Client Interaction: Engage with clients professionally to address their concerns and provide project updates.
  • Supervise and Lead: Guide and instruct a small crew, ensuring efficient and effective performance of landscaping tasks.
  • Tools and

Material Management:
Ensure all tools and materials are well-maintained and accounted for daily.

  • Training & Development: Mentor helpers, preparing them for progression within the company.
  • Quality Control: Uphold high standards of quality to ensure client satisfaction with each project.
  • Garden &

Landscape Maintenance:
Direct regular maintenance activities such as planting, pruning, weeding, fertilizing, mowing and edging.

  • Problem Identification & Reporting: Detect and report gardening issues to the office for timely resolution.
  • Tree Trimming: Monitor the health and aesthetics of trees and coordinate with the office for necessary trimming.
  • Watering & Irrigation: Manage watering schedules and irrigation systems, correcting any irregularities.
  • Experience: Minimum of 3 years in garden and landscape maintenance with leadership responsibilities.
  • Leadership Skills: Strong ability to manage and motivate a team.
  • Coachable: Receptive to feedback and able to utilize new learning.
  • Horticultural Knowledge: Wellversed in plant care, irrigation systems, and horticultural practices.
  • Problem-Solving: Capable of identifying and resolving landscaperelated issues promptly.
  • Communication: Excellent interpersonal skills for effective communication with both team members and clients.
  • Organizational Skills: Able to manage time and resources effectively for optimal workflow.
  • Physical Fitness: Must be capable of performing physical labor in various weather conditions.
  • Must have a valid California driver's license.
